Transaction 592fc995376d08c1d54683948ecdc28eade535317b1faa2a2345d0effdd7e003

1 Input
2 Outputs
  • 592fc995376d08c1d54683948ecdc28eade535317b1faa2a2345d0effdd7e003:0
  • value  816723
    address  3EsQauhQCTz5JG81rUioQt5fjPZFBd9A34
  • 592fc995376d08c1d54683948ecdc28eade535317b1faa2a2345d0effdd7e003:1
  • value  1419937
    address  32WCUHhxAF3XgWsZgFcEYvLBtZD2ZHErYi